Should I elevate my water heater in flood-prone New Orleans?
Absolutely. FEMA and Louisiana building codes recommend or require elevating water heaters in flood zones. MaxRooter installs elevated water heater platforms and flood-resistant connections in New Orleans, Kenner, Slidell, and throughout southeast Louisiana.
